HELPP PLEASEEEEE<br> How does stress affect the body? 3-5 sentences
horrorfan [7]
Long-term activation of your body’s stress response system, along with prolonged exposure to cortisol and other stress hormones, puts you at risk for health troubles. These health issues include digestive problems, anxiety, headaches, depression, sleep problems, weight gain, memory and concentration issues, high blood pressure, heart disease and strokes. Being stressed also lowers your threshold for pain, causing more extreme discomfort from the previous affects.
